The Trace
Method.

Safety sensors operate on a low-voltage heartbeat. When a wire is cut or a short is detected, the entire automation fails. We trace the break to its origin.

Phase 01 // Diagnostics

Signal
Injection

We inject a diagnostic frequency into the circuit to locate the precise point of resistance or termination along the wire path.

Phase 02 // Splicing

Micro
Soldering

Environmental-grade splicing using heat-shrink containment to ensure the repair withstands Paterson's industrial climate and vibration.

Phase 03 // Validation

Logic
Handshake

A software-level validation to ensure the motor recognizes the sensor status and resets the safety lockout protocols.
